Korea Electric Power Corporation (KEPCO) reported preliminary, unaudited first-quarter 2026 results prepared under K-IFRS. On a consolidated basis, operating revenues were ₩24,398 billion, slightly above ₩24,224 billion a year earlier, while operating income was ₩3,784 billion versus ₩3,754 billion.
Consolidated net income reached ₩2,519 billion, up from ₩2,362 billion, with net income attributable to owners at ₩2,493 billion compared with ₩2,328 billion. On a separate-company basis, KEPCO recorded operating revenues of ₩23,709 billion and net income of ₩3,239 billion, both higher profitability than in 2025 despite slightly lower revenue. The company emphasizes these figures are preliminary and have not been audited or reviewed by its independent accountants.

KEPCO shows stronger profitability on stable first-quarter revenue.
KEPCO reports largely flat consolidated revenue but higher profits for the first quarter of 2026. Consolidated operating income of ₩3,784 billion and net income of ₩2,519 billion both exceed the prior-year period despite only a small revenue increase.
On a separate basis, operating revenue dipped slightly to ₩23,709 billion, yet operating income rose to ₩2,087 billion and net income to ₩3,239 billion. This suggests improved cost control or mix, although detailed drivers are not provided in the excerpt.
The figures are explicitly labeled as preliminary and unaudited under K-IFRS, so they may change when fully reviewed. Subsequent filings for the fiscal year 2026 will provide more detail on underlying cost trends and any revisions to these estimates.
